Matterport (NASDAQ:MTTR – Free Report) had its target price boosted by Piper Sandler from $3.00 to $5.50 in a research note issued to investors on Monday morning, Benzinga reports. Piper Sandler currently has a neutral rating on the stock.
Other equities research analysts have also recently issued research reports about the company. BTIG Research assumed coverage on Matterport in a research note on Friday, January 19th. They set a neutral rating for the company. Wedbush decreased their target price on Matterport from $5.00 to $4.00 and set a neutral rating for the company in a research note on Thursday, February 22nd. Finally, Northland Securities assumed coverage on Matterport in a research note on Thursday, April 11th. They set an outperform rating and a $3.50 target price for the company. Four anal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and one has assigned a buy r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at, the stock has a consensus rating of Hold and an average target price of $3.90.

Matterport (NASDAQ:MTTR –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, February 20th. The company reported ($0.14) earnings per share for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of ($0.14). The company had revenue of $39.55 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$40.11 million. Matterport had a negative return on equity of 36.35% and a negative net margin of 126.20%. Sell-side analysts forecast that Matterport will post -0.45 earnings per share for the current year.

Matterport Company Profile
Matterport, Inc, a spatial data company, focuses on digitization and datafication in the United States and internationally. The company offers Matterport Capture Services, a fully managed solution for enterprise subscribers; Matterport Pro3, a 3D camera that scans properties; Matterport Pro2, a 3D camera that captures spaces; LEICA BLK360, a device to create digital twins; Smartphone Capture, a smartphone capture solution for both iOS and Android; and 360 Cameras.
